The show also introduced the brilliant concept of the "Opens"—perceptible only to the Te Xuan Ze and children under a certain age. Adults literally cannot see the 12-foot ogre standing next to the hot dog stand. This allows for hilarious visual gags (a monster disguised as a fire hydrant) and a tragic metaphor: growing up means losing the ability to see the magic in the world.
